Default 4 Film Favorites: Lethal Weapon Collection

(I created this thread in the hopes that the mods will create a section for Problematic Discs and Packaging.)

--------------------------------------------------


https://www.blu-ray.com/movies/4-Fil...Blu-ray/73984/

On May 28, 2013, Warner released several "4 Film Favorites" sets (currently Best Buy Exclusives, though none of the discs include new content). They all use cases that come with stacked discs (two on each spindle).

Additionally, the Lethal Weapon Collection has these problems:

1st batch -- Lethal Weapon 1 is the old disc from 2006 instead of the new disc from the 2012 box set. Lethal Weapon 2 is actually the Swordfish Blu-ray. Lethal Weapon 3 and 4 are from the 2012 box set.

2nd batch -- Lethal Weapon 1 is still the old disc from 2006. Lethal Weapon 2, 3, and 4 are from the 2012 box set.

Bear in mind that the 2012 box set includes a fifth disc with additional Bonus Features.

Best Buy pulled the problematic first batch from store shelves, though some people may not be aware of this issue if they didn't try to play Lethal Weapon 2.

Also, even if you don't watch Bonus Features, the picture and audio quality of the first movie are not as good as those of the remastered versions of the second, third, and fourth movie.

Buyer beware!

I can't comment on the UK version mentioned above, but the North American version of the 5-disc collection comes in a blu-ray keepcase that is just slightly thicker than your average single sized case (which this 4 Film Favorites version comes in). Unless you're so strapped for shelf space that 1-2 mm makes a difference, there shouldn't be an issue with shelf space if you get the 5-disc collection, particularly if you sell/shred/recycle the slipcover.

Default Costco has these sets with the old LW1 Disc

LW2-4 are fine, but the original is still DD 5.1 with the old transfer. Back of the slipcase still says DTS-HD MA English 5.1.

Buyer beware. Mine's going back unfortunately.
